Price cuts offered by the Indian marque is up to ₹15,743 ahead of festive season.
Hero MotoCorp has announced it will pass on the entire benefit of GST 2.0 reforms directly to customers, with the price reductions taking effect from September 22, 2025.
The largest Indian two-wheeler manufacturers says the move aims to improve accessibility and affordability of two-wheelers, particularly benefiting rural and semi-urban communities where these vehicles serve as essential transport for daily mobility and income generation.
Customers can now access savings of up to ₹15,743 on selected models (ex-showroom Delhi), covering popular motorcycles from the Splendor+, Glamour, and Xtreme ranges, alongside scooters including the Xoom, Destini, and Pleasure+ series. Here is a detailed table on how much you stand to gain from each model:
Models | Max GST benefit (Ex. Showroom Delhi) |
Hero Destini 125 | Up to ₹7,197 |
Hero Glamour X | Up to ₹7,813 |
Hero HF Deluxe | Up to ₹5,805 |
Hero Karizma 210 | Up to ₹15,743 |
Hero Passion+ | Up to ₹6,500 |
Hero Pleasure+ | Up to ₹6,417 |
Hero Splendor+ | Up to ₹6,820 |
Hero Super Splendor Xtec | Up to ₹7,254 |
Hero Xoom 110 | Up to ₹6,597 |
Hero Xoom 125 | Up to ₹7,291 |
Hero Xoom 160 | Up to ₹11,602 |
Hero XPulse 210 | Up to ₹14,516 |
Hero Xtreme 125R | Up to ₹8,010 |
Hero Xtreme 160R 4V | Up to ₹10,895 |
Hero Xtreme 250R | Up to ₹14,055 |
“We welcome the Government’s next-gen GST 2.0 reforms, which will boost consumption, empower GDP growth, and accelerate India’s journey to a $ 5 trillion economy. In addition, more than half of the Indian households use two-wheelers for their daily needs, making it critical for mass mobility. The timing is opportune and ahead of the festive season, making two-wheelers more affordable and accessible for India’s largest consumer base, while giving a strong demand push. By passing on the full GST benefit to customers, Hero MotoCorp reaffirms its commitment to enabling mobility, empowering families, and supporting the vision of ‘Make in India’,” said Vikram Kasbekar, Chief Executive Officer, Hero MotoCorp.
